If the null hypothesis is not rejected, [Sir Ronald] Fisher's position was that nothing could be concluded. But researchers find it hard to go to all the trouble of conducting a study only to conclude that nothing can be concluded.
Statistical Significance Testing and Cumulative Knowledge in, Psychology: Implications for Training of Researchers, Psychological Methods, Volume 1, Number 2, 1996
